A skiing guide to Whistler resorts

The Canadian resort town of Whistler has been among the world's top skiing destinations for over twenty years. Over two million people hit the slopes annually and if you plan to be one of them, this will guide you through Whistler's skiing terrain from gentle inclines and cross country trails to challenging off-piste adventures. This article provides a guide to Whistler resorts.

Where is Whistler?

Whistler is located in the Coast Mountains of Canada, BC approximately 125 kilometres north of Vancouver. Whistler Village encompasses both Whistler and Blackcomb mountains and is generally regarded as the number one ski resort in North America and Canada.

Ski runs

Whistler boasts a total of 8, 171 acres of piste with slopes for skiers and snowboarders of all levels. With over two hundred runs and thirty-three ski lifts, skiers are spoiled for choice. Beginners Whilst both mountains offer a variety of easy beginner slopes, the majority of long, gentle runs are located at Blackcomb. Beginners also have the opportunity to join in a ski school or private lesson, sure to have them skiing the mountain in no time. Intermediate Over fifty percent of Whistler ski runs are of intermediate level with plenty of options on both mountains. A great option to explore all the runs on offer is the Peak to Peak gondola which takes skiers between locations. Advanced Whistler and Blackcomb offer plenty of challenges for even the most advanced skier. In addition to a large number of advanced runs, the resort offers over half-a million acres of back country terrain for hair-raising off-piste skiing. Cross-Country skiing and snowboarding

Whistler offers plenty of options for both snowboarders and cross-country skiers. In addition to more than two hundred ski runs, snowboarders have five terrain parks and two half-pipes to test their skills whilst twenty-eight kilometres of trails are available for cross-country skiers to explore.

Accommodation

Whistler Resort offers a wide range of accommodation options from chateau hotels, lodges, self-contained apartments and convenient ski in ski out resorts.
